Every Lamphun area, scored.

The BAANLYY Area Score rates all 4 Lamphun living areas on a transparent 100-point scale, built from eight lived-experience factors. One number to compare at a glance — then dig into the detail that matters for a small, historic province half an hour from Chiang Mai.

Share

How it's scored: each area is rated 1–10 on eight factors — value, infrastructure & services, culture & heritage, quiet, Chiang Mai access, rental depth, walkability and family suitability — and the BAANLYY Area Score is their average on a 0–100 scale. Structured data is thin for a province this small (see the where-to-live guide), so these scores are deliberately conservative and directional rather than precise. It's a transparent comparison starting point, not investment advice — weight the factors that matter to you.

Why is 'Chiang Mai access' one of the factors?Because in Lamphun it is the single most consequential piece of practical geography. The province has no airport, no tertiary hospital and no international school of its own — all three sit about half an hour north in Chiang Mai. How far you are from that city genuinely changes daily life here, which is why it replaces the generic 'transport access' factor used in cities with their own airport and rail hub.
How should I use the score in Lamphun?Use the overall score to shortlist, then dig into the factor that matters most for how you'll actually live here — anyone wanting walkability, temples and the hospital weighs culture and walkability toward the old town; anyone posted to a northern plant weighs rental depth toward Ban Klang; commuters weigh Chiang Mai access toward Ban Thi; and anyone chasing value and quiet weighs those toward the southern Pa Sang districts.
